Date: Tue, 15 May 2001 11:37:17 -0400 Reply-To: Maryland Birds & Birding Sender: Maryland Birds & Birding From: Michael Bowen Subject: DC sightings, May 15 Comments: To: voice@capaccess.org Mime-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set="us-ascii"; format=flowed Highlights of today's visits to Kenilworth Park (KP), Kenilworth Aquatic Gardens (KAG), Anacostia park (AP) and Anacostia Wetlands (AW) and nearby areas in DC were: o 3 singing WILLOW FLYCATCHERS: one at KP, adjacent to the Kenilworth mash, another (well seen) at River Terrace Park, just downstream of the Benning Rd. bridge, and yet another at AW, where the species probably bred last year. o There were 3 female Bobolinks in the no-mow area at KP at about 7:45 a.m. and a single CHESTNUT-SIDED WARBLER singing in the trees. o KAG had lots of swallows - mostly TREE, N. ROUGH-WINGED and BARN, with at least 6 BANK SWALLOWS in with them (first of the year for me). CHIMNEY SWIFTS were also abundant -- at least 50 over KP. KAG also had at least a dozen SPOTTED SANDPIPER and an equal number of SOLITARY SANDPIPER. o River Terrace park had 6 LEAST SANDPIPERS together with 2 more SPOTTED. o AP had a CASPIAN TERN in with lots of RING-BILLED GULLS. o AP had both ORIOLE SPECIES and EASTERN KINGBIRDS along the river.
